About Elizabeth Meckes

Elizabeth Meckes is a scholar working on Statistics and Probability, Mathematical Physics and Applied Mathematics, having authored 9 papers that have together received 180 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Random Matrices and Applications (5 papers), Point processes and geometric inequalities (4 papers) and Advanced Algebra and Geometry (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Mathematical Physics (67 citations), Discrete Mathematics and Combinatorics (22 citations) and Statistics and Probability (54 citations). Elizabeth Meckes has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Matthew Kahle and Mark W. Meckes. Their work appears in journals such as Transactions of the American Mathematical Society, Probability Theory and Related Fields and Journal of Theoretical Probability.
